Vitamin D Synthesis and Mood Regulation

Child in bright sunlight representing Vitamin D synthesis

Sunlight Exposure Parameters

  • Ultraviolet B (UVB) radiation.

  • Epidermal 7-dehydrocholesterol conversion.

  • Vitamin D3 production.

  • Serum 25(OH)D levels.

Psychological Correlation

  • Serotonin synthesis catalyst.

  • Mood stabilization.

  • Seasonal Affective Disorder (SAD) mitigation.

  • Depression risk reduction.

  • Anxiety symptom management.

Physiological Impact: Children

  • Skeletal development support.

  • Immune system modulation.

  • Circadian rhythm regulation.

  • Sleep-wake cycle synchronization.

Physiological Impact: Adults

  • Bone density maintenance.

  • Cognitive decline prevention.

  • Systemic inflammation reduction.

  • Neuroprotective properties.

Cortisol Reduction and Stress Mitigation

Adult walking on a forest trail representing stress reduction

Nature Exposure Data

  • Biophilia hypothesis.

  • Attention Restoration Theory (ART).

  • Stress Recovery Theory (SRT).

  • 10-minute minimum threshold.

Biometric Outcomes

  • Salivary cortisol decrease.

  • Diastolic blood pressure reduction.

  • Systolic blood pressure reduction.

  • Heart rate variability (HRV) improvement.

Neurological Shifts

  • Prefrontal cortex deactivation (rest).

  • Amygdala reactivity reduction.

  • Subgenual prefrontal cortex activity decrease.

  • Rumination cessation.

  • Negative thought pattern disruption.

Environment Variables

  • Green space (parks, forests).

  • Blue space (rivers, oceans).

  • Biodiversity density.

  • Acoustic naturalism (birdsong, water).

Neurochemical Responses to Physical Play

Active outdoor play representing endorphin release

Endorphin Mechanisms

  • Opioid receptor binding.

  • Pain threshold elevation.

  • Euphoria induction ("runner's high").

  • Stress response buffering.

Neurotransmitter Modulation

  • Dopamine release (reward processing).

  • Norepinephrine increase (alertness).

  • Serotonin availability (emotional balance).

  • Brain-derived neurotrophic factor (BDNF) production.

Active Play Categories: Children

  • Gross motor skill engagement.

  • Proprioceptive input.

  • Vestibular stimulation.

  • Unstructured risk-taking.

Active Play Categories: Adults

  • Recreational sports.

  • Aerobic trail activity.

  • Functional movement.

  • Playful social competition.

Psychological Outcomes

  • Self-esteem enhancement.

  • Body image improvement.

  • Mastery experience gain.

  • Resilience building.
